History of the Nottingham Forest v Reading fixture

Nottm. Forest prepare to entertain Reading at City Ground on Saturday afternoon, and hold the advantage on previous meetings between the two. Of the 12 games played, Forest have recorded 6 wins, and Reading have come away with 3 victories.

The most recent encounter between these two sides at City Ground was less than a year ago, in January 2004, with Reading inflicting a narrow 0-1 defeat upon the Forest in a League Division One match.

Recent respective form guides

Nottingham Forest have managed to pick up just two wins from their last six home games, losing three, The Forest's have scored 8 goals in these games, but conceded an alarming 10.

Reading have an average recent record on the road, with two wins, two draws, and two defeats. A generous 8 goals have been both scored and conceded in this period.

Nottm. Forest are stuck down in the relegation zone of Coca-Cola Championship with a return of just 14 points from their 19 games thus far. Reading are just outside the promotion places, in 3rd, having taken 37 points from 19 games.
